Features
Typical Applications
The HMC667LP2(E) is ideal for:
• WiMAX, WiBro & Fixed Wireless
• SDARS & WLAN Receivers
• Infrastructure & Repeaters
• Access Points
Low Noise Figure: 0.75 dB
High Gain: 19 dB
High Output IP3: +29.5 dBm
Single Supply: +3V to +5V
6 Lead 2x2mm DFN Package: 4 mm2

General Description
The HMC667LP2(E) is a GaAs PHEMT MMIC Low
Noise Amplifier that is ideal for WiMAX, WLAN and
fixed wireless receivers operating between 2300
and 2700 MHz. This self-biased LNA has been
optimized to provide 0.75 dB noise figure, 19 dB
gain and +29.5 dBm output IP3 from a single supply
of +5V. Input and output return losses are excellent
and the LNA requires minimal external matching and
bias decoupling components. The HMC667LP2(E)
can also operate from a +3V supply for lower power
applications.
